For the first question: The Sun generates energy via nuclear fusion in its core, where hydrogen nuclei fuse to form helium. This process consumes hydrogen and produces helium, so hydrogen decreases while helium increases over time.
For the second question: Space is a near-vacuum, so conduction (requires particles) and convection (requires a fluid medium) cannot transfer energy through it. Sound waves also need a medium to travel. Solar energy reaches Earth via electromagnetic radiation, which can propagate through empty space.
